## Formula sandbox tuning

User-supplied formulas in Gridmoor execute inside a restricted interpreter with hard ceilings on time, memory, and call depth. Reviewers should confirm any change to these ceilings is justified in the PR description, since raising them widens the abuse surface. Defaults were chosen from production traces. The current limits are as follows.

limits module of tafog-fawip:
WEIGHTS = {
    "julix": 57,
    "lamys": 992,
    "kasvan": 209,
    "quenok": 750,
    "alddor": 259,
    "oliath": 1009,
    "wenix": 815,
}

Q3 Planning Note — Board

Quick update: Varnellia is ready to push into the Kestrel Coast region. Demand signals from our pilot in Port Amberly look strong, and Mira Oltven's team has lined up two distribution partners. We'll need roughly one quarter of runway before revenue lands. Full details on the expansion strategy follow below.

confidential, kagep-kahof: Druokax Systems plans to lower the Ulaath list price by 53 percent in March.

Hey Priya — welcome aboard! Quick handover on Squatwatch, our typo-squatting package scanner. It polls the registry mirror hourly, scores new package names against our internal namespace using edit distance plus a keyboard-adjacency heuristic, and files tickets for anything above 0.8. False positives mostly come from the "kestrel-" prefix — there's an allowlist for that. Cron config lives in the deploy repo. Onboarding steps, scoring docs, and the allowlist process are all written up here:

operations page: https://jenkins.zemvarcloud.local/job/merge_requests/repo/build/73930b4b30f0a8ed

# Nightfill Environments

Quick tour for reviewers: Nightfill (our nightly backfill scheduler) runs in three environments — sandbox, staging, and prod. Sandbox fakes the warehouse entirely, staging points at a trimmed snapshot, and prod does the real 2am sweep. Please don't approve PRs that hardcode cron strings; everything flows from config. For reference, staging currently runs with the following values.

settings of fafog-haduf:
ZORIX_PIN=4648
ZORIX_METRICS_HOST=metrics.zorix.paliqsys.corp
ZORIX_LOG_LEVEL=info
ZORIX_TENANT=druix